Warning Signs You Need Hydrostatic Pressure Water Removal

Catching hydrostatic pressure water damage early saves money and prevents bigger problems. Here are some common signs to look out for:

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away

Strong, persistent odors can be a sign of hidden moisture and mold growth. Don’t ignore these signs, act quickly to prevent further damage.

Water Stains on Ceilings and Walls

Visible water stains can show a more serious issue lurking beneath the surface. Don’t delay in addressing these signs.

Buckling or Warping Floors

Warped or buckling floors can be a sign of hidden damage. Get your floors checked by a professional to prevent further damage.

Unexplained Mold Growth

Mold growth is a clear sign of excess moisture and can pose serious health risks. Take action immediately to prevent the spread of mold.

Increased Energy Bills

Unexplained increases in energy bills can show a more serious issue, such as hidden water damage. Get to the bottom of the issue before it’s too late.

Peeling Paint or Wallpaper

Peeling paint or wallpaper can be a sign of hidden moisture and damage. Don’t delay in addressing these signs.

Hydrostatic Pressure Water Removal vs. DIY: When to Call a Professional

Situation DIY? Call a Pro? Why
Small leak in a bathroom Yes Maybe Easy to fix with basic plumbing skills and equipment.
Major flood in a basement No Yes Needs specialized equipment and expertise to extract water and prevent mold growth.
Water stains on a ceiling No Yes Can show hidden damage and need specialized inspection and repair.
Excess moisture in a crawl space Maybe Yes Can need specialized equipment and expertise to extract water and prevent mold growth.
Peeling paint or wallpaper No Yes Can show hidden moisture and damage, needing specialized inspection and repair.
Unexplained mold growth No Yes Can pose serious health risks and need specialized equipment and expertise to remove.

Hydrostatic Pressure Water Removal Cost in Prairie City, IA

The cost of hydrostatic pressure water removal varies based on the severity, size of the affected area, and local conditions in Prairie City, IA. But, here are some estimated price ranges for common services:

Service Typical Price Range What Affects Cost
Water Extraction $500 – $2,500 Size of affected area, severity of damage
Drywall and Flooring Removal $1,000 – $5,000 Size of affected area, type of flooring and drywall
Dehumidification and Drying $500 – $2,000 Size of affected area, severity of damage
Final Inspection and Restoration $1,000 – $3,000 Size of affected area, type of damage
IICRC Certification and Insurance Claims $500 – $1,500 Complexity of claims process, type of insurance
Free Estimate and Inspection $0 – $200 Size of affected area, type of damage
